The Indian Railways are the second largest railway system in the world. It houses over 62,300 km. of track laid between 7000 stations and over 11,000 locomotives. It offers diverse tourist routes, magnificent train-hotels on wheels with five-star services and Indrail Passes, ideal for extensive trouble-free tours across the country that are exciting both for Indians and foreigners.
The Indian Railways operates Luxury Tourist Trains such as 'Palace on Wheels', 'Fairy Queen', 'Deccan Odyssey' and 'The Royal Orient'. Besides, Railways also runs steam hauled toy-trains like the 'Kalka-Shimla Toy Train' in hills that offer quaint experience.

Train tour to India gets for you some of the most luxurious train adventures in the world in Palace of Wheels and The Royal Orient trains. These Trains cover the Royal Rajasthan & Gujarat respectively.
The toy trains of the Himalayan sectors offer the breath taking scenic beauties of the region. One is known as The Shimla Toy Train. It runs from Kalka to Simla. The other Toy Train runs from New JalPaiGuri to Darjeeling.
